I am absolutely blown away at what this small organization has accomplished in 2007. I am not a huge numbers person. In fact, I dislike math greatly (probably because I am not good at it), but for all you statisticians out there, take a look at these numbers:

Overall:

  • 213 - the number of volunteers who served during 2007
  • 8,480 - the number of hours spent working in the mission field by staff and volunteers
  • 44 - the number of work orders that were completed

Home Mission Efforts:

  • 59% - the percentage of work orders completed locally
  • 75% - the percentage of our volunteers who served locally
  • 16% - the increase in field hours served locally over 2006
  • 1000+ lbs. - the amount of clothes collected for local charities

Not to mention, Phase 2 of Morningside Park was completed. Local organizations received assistance and volunteer for events and projects. Many elderly and needy received yard care and home repairs. Youth groups were given resources and studies & activities held. And this is just a snapshot of what F2W accomplished in its hometown during 2007. But what is most important is that within these numbers are countless individuals who were served and loved.

In 2008 we will continue our focus on Local Missions. The Leadership Team believes strongly that service begins at home.
